How It Compares With Other Autumn-Themed Assets

Not all autumn-themed graphics serve the same purpose. Stock photo libraries often offer high-res leaf close-ups, but those are single-image files—not seamless patterns. They work well for hero banners or social media posts, but fail when tiled: edges don’t align, and scaling introduces distortion. Similarly, free pattern generators or AI-assisted tile tools may produce quick repeats, but lack consistent line weight, intentional negative space, or professional color harmonies. The Autumn. Fall Leaf. Seamless Pattern bridges that gap by offering both precision and practicality.

Compared to hand-drawn or watercolor-based autumn patterns, this version leans toward clean, scalable clarity—ideal for branding consistency or production workflows where color matching matters (e.g., Pantone-referenced stationery). Watercolor variants excel in artisanal contexts—think handmade greeting cards or boutique packaging—but introduce texture variability that can complicate CMYK printing or screen printing on dark fabrics. This pattern’s flat, layered vector structure gives users full control over ink coverage, transparency, and contrast.

Tradeoffs and Limitations to Consider

No single pattern suits every scenario. The Autumn. Fall Leaf. Seamless Pattern excels in structured, repeat-driven applications—but it isn’t optimized for narrative illustration. If your project requires storytelling (e.g., a children’s book spread showing falling leaves in motion), a custom illustration or scene-based asset would be more appropriate. Likewise, while the EPS allows color edits, it doesn’t include layered PSD files with shadow or texture effects—so adding dimensional depth requires manual work in Photoshop or similar tools.

Also, although the palette is seasonally resonant, it doesn’t include cool-toned autumn variants (e.g., slate-blue or lavender-tinged foliage) sometimes used in modern or gender-neutral designs. Users needing those hues must adjust saturation manually rather than selecting from pre-built swatches.

Evaluating Alternatives Thoughtfully

Before choosing any autumn pattern, consider three decision factors: output medium, required editability, and consistency expectations. For example:

  1. If you’re printing 500 custom napkins with foil stamping, vector precision and spot-color readiness matter more than decorative variety—making the Autumn. Fall Leaf. Seamless Pattern a strong candidate.
  2. If you’re designing a set of four distinct social media banners—one per week leading up to Thanksgiving—you may prefer four separate, non-tiling illustrations to convey progression, rather than one repeating motif.
  3. If your team includes non-designers who need to tweak colors via simple sliders, a web-based pattern generator with live previews might reduce friction—even if final output quality is lower.

Also weigh long-term reuse. A single-use photo background may suffice for one campaign, but the Autumn. Fall Leaf. Seamless Pattern supports multiple seasons’ worth of iterations: shift hues for fall 2024, simplify outlines for a minimalist spring reinterpretation, or invert colors for holiday contrast. That longevity offsets its upfront cost compared to disposable assets.
